summaryrefslogtreecommitdiff
path: root/extraction
diff options
context:
space:
mode:
Diffstat (limited to 'extraction')
-rw-r--r--extraction/Makefile5
1 files changed, 4 insertions, 1 deletions
diff --git a/extraction/Makefile b/extraction/Makefile
index 038b3d0..9dc6351 100644
--- a/extraction/Makefile
+++ b/extraction/Makefile
@@ -36,9 +36,13 @@ COQEXEC=coqtop $(COQINCL) -batch -load-vernac-source
../ccomp: $(FILES:.ml=.cmo)
$(OCAMLC) -o ../ccomp $(FILES:.ml=.cmo)
+clean::
+ rm -f ../ccomp
../ccomp.opt: Pack.cmx
$(OCAMLOPT) -o ../ccomp.opt Pack.cmx
+clean::
+ rm -f ../ccomp.opt
Pack.cmx: $(FILES:.ml=.cmx)
$(OCAMLOPT) -pack -o Pack.cmx $(FILES:.ml=.cmx)
@@ -81,7 +85,6 @@ clean::
rm -f $(GENFILES)
rm -f *.cm? *.o
cd ../caml && rm -f *.cm? *.o
- rm -f ccomp
depend: beforedepend
$(OCAMLDEP) ../caml/*.mli ../caml/*.ml *.mli *.ml > .depend